What Is AEO and Why Does It Matter for Surprise Franchise Locations?
AEO stands for Answer Engine Optimization. It’s the practice of structuring your franchise location’s content, schema markup, and Google Business Profile so that AI-powered tools — Google SGE, Siri, Alexa, ChatGPT, and Bing Copilot — pull your business as the direct answer to a user’s question.
Traditional SEO gets you ranked. AEO gets you cited. There’s a meaningful difference. When someone in the Greer Ranch community asks “which HVAC franchise is open on Sunday near Surprise, AZ,” the answer engine doesn’t show a list of ten blue links. It reads one answer aloud. If that answer isn’t your location, the call never comes in.

AEO Strategy Built Specifically for the Surprise, Arizona Market
Local Schema Markup That Speaks to Greer Ranch Residents
Structured data is the language of answer engines. When your franchise location page carries proper LocalBusiness schema — including your service area (Greer Ranch, Marley Park, Surprise Farms, and neighboring Peoria and El Mirage), your hours, your accepted payment types, and a curated FAQ block — Google’s AI has everything it needs to surface your location as a direct answer.

Conversational FAQ Content That Gets Cited
Answer engines are trained on conversational language. If your franchise location’s page answers questions the way a human would ask them — “Does [your brand] in Surprise offer same-day service?” or “Is there a franchise location near Greer Ranch that handles commercial accounts?” — you dramatically increase the probability of being cited. AEO vs. SEO: What Franchise Owners in Greer Ranch Actually Need
SEO and AEO are not competing strategies — they’re layered. Strong local SEO gets your franchise location ranking in traditional results. AEO gets you cited in AI answers and voice results on top of that. For franchise owners, the practical distinction is this: your SEO foundation (citations, backlinks, on-page optimization) is largely built once and maintained. AEO is an ongoing content and structure discipline that compound over time as answer engines grow more sophisticated and more users rely on them.

Frequently Asked Questions: AEO for Franchises in Surprise, Arizona
What is AEO and how is it different from regular SEO?
AEO (Answer Engine Optimization) focuses on structuring your content and schema markup so that AI assistants, voice search tools, and Google’s featured snippets select your business as the direct answer to a user’s question. Traditional SEO focuses on ranking your pages in search results. AEO gets your franchise location cited by AI tools — a step above ranking that captures users before they even click a link.
